What is Bandwidth?

Bandwidth sells trust in the call, and self-service everywhere it used to sell tickets.

The release stream splits cleanly in two: one entry that adds a product line and a run of entries that remove reasons to open a support ticket. Identity Presentation, in beta since mid-August, is the product line — branded, authenticated caller identity rendered on the handset. Everything since has been console and self-service work: RCS test-number management, Voice API debug logs surfaced in Voice Insights, port-in FOC changes and cancellations up to ten minutes before the port, MOS scores in the app, and now 10DLC campaign registration moving out of API-only access into the Bandwidth App alongside brand sharing across accounts.

What is Zoho Mail?

Zoho Mail is turning the inbox into a workspace and selling it through AWS

Zoho Mail's recent releases pull in two directions. One is scope: Web Tabs embed the websites and tools people keep alongside email directly in the client, ZeptoMail's transactional sending now connects to the same platform, and an MCP server exposes the inbox to assistants. The other is enterprise administration — email journaling for long-term records, incoming and outgoing rules positioned as fraud control, and an SE Labs security award. The newest entry is neither: a listing on AWS Marketplace so Premium can be bought and billed through an AWS account.

◆ Where it's heading

The registration surfaces are converging on a single console. 10DLC and RCS both have Registration Centers, both reached the app within a week of each other, and both took the same API-first, UI-second order — integrators served first, operators after. The reseller item is the more consequential half of this release: sharing brands natively across accounts treats the multi-account hierarchy as a first-class structure rather than something customers duplicate records to work around, which matters for the wholesale and reseller business that carrier-adjacent vendors depend on.

◆ Prediction

Expect the remaining registration and porting workflows to follow the same API-then-UI path into the Bandwidth App, and the RCS Registration Center to pick up the cross-account brand sharing that 10DLC just received. Whether Identity Presentation leaves beta is the open question these entries do not answer.

◆ Where it's heading

The product is being built outward from the mailbox rather than deeper into it. Web Tabs is the clearest statement — Zoho would rather be the surface you never leave than the best client you switch away from — and the ZeptoMail connection folds the machine-generated half of a company's email into the same platform. The AWS Marketplace listing addresses a different obstacle entirely: enterprises whose software procurement runs through Marketplace could not buy this without a separate purchasing process.

◆ Prediction

Expect more consolidation of adjacent Zoho services into the mail surface, following the ZeptoMail pattern, and further administrative controls aimed at buyers evaluating a Microsoft 365 migration.
